The Bidford-on-Avon Conservation Area covers the medieval core, where 14th to 16th-century buildings and the church of St Laurence overlook the River Avon. Bidford Bridge, both Grade I listed and a scheduled monument, carries eight stone arches across the Avon and is thought to have been built by the monks of Bordesley Abbey in the early 15th century.

When do you need a skip permit in Warwickshire?
Across Warwickshire, a skip permit is required when the skip will sit on a public road, pavement or grass verge. In Bidford-on-Avon the current charge is £100 for the standard permit period. Skips on private property (driveway, off-street parking) are exempt. Applications typically need 5 working days' notice and are arranged on your behalf when you book.

Wait-and-load
Wait-and-load is available across West Midlands for locations where a skip can't sit on the road or a driveway. No permit is required. The lorry arrives, waits while you load the skip in place, then leaves with the waste.

After we collect your skip in Bidford-on-Avon, the load is delivered to a licensed waste transfer station. It is then tipped and separated into material types: wood, metal, hardcore, plasterboard, plastics and mixed residue.
Compliance with waste regulations
Every Bidford-on-Avon skip hire booking is covered by a valid waste carrier licence, registered with the Environment Agency. A waste transfer note is generated automatically at booking, meeting duty-of-care obligations set out in the Environmental Protection Act 1990.
Recycling and landfill
Recoverable material is directed to UK recyclers: metal to smelters, wood to biomass, hardcore to aggregate. Only West Midlands skip waste with no recovery potential goes to landfill. Nationally, around 90% of skip waste is recycled or recovered (WRAP UK, 2023).
